fdisk440 should be revised or just excluded. It is compiled to 32bit which is no more supported.

There is a better way to install mbr0 sector sizeof 440

dd if=/dev/disk0 count=1 bs=512 of=origMBR
cp origMBR newMBR
dd if=boot0 of=newMBR bs=1 count=440 conv=notrunc
dd if=newMBR of=/dev/disk0 count=1 bs=512

Someone can implement this into Clover Package? And completely exclude fdisk440.

 

EDITED.

Or /dev/rdisk0 ?

5 hours ago, arsradu said:

 

Seems to be 1.


192-168-0-116:~ jimmy$ xcodebuild -version | sed -nE 's/^Xcode ([0-9]).*/\1/p'
1
192-168-0-116:~ jimmy$ 

 

I excluded Xcode version check in 4538. It was needed for Xcode 3 and 4. Now I think xcode is always >=5.

If anyone want old versions then welcome with your proposition how to do better way.

6 hours ago, arsradu said:

 

Seems to be 1.


192-168-0-116:~ jimmy$ xcodebuild -version | sed -nE 's/^Xcode ([0-9]).*/\1/p'
1
192-168-0-116:~ jimmy$ 

 

Check, please

xcodebuild -version | sed -nE 's/^Xcode ([0-9]+).*/\1/p'
